原文:简单理解Vue中的nextTick

Vue.nextTick是Vue官方给我们提供的一个API 方法 ,作用是在下次DOM更新循环结束之后执行延迟回调。在修改数据之后立即使用这个方法,获取更新后的DOM 那么我们的理解是:当数据发生变化之后,DOM视图并不会立即更新,如果我们在发生变化之后立马去获取某个节点或者某个节点的值,很有可能结果就是undefined 因为Vue实现响应式并不是数据发生变化之后DOM立即变化,而是按一定的策 ...

2019-10-07 15:24 0 496 推荐指数:

查看详情

【转】简单理解VuenextTick

前言:   VuenextTick涉及到VueDOM的异步更新,感觉很有意思,特意了解了一下。其中关于nextTick的源码涉及到不少知识,很多不太理解,暂且根据自己的一些感悟介绍下nextTick。 一、示例   先来一个示例了解下关于Vue的DOM更新以及nextTick的作用 ...

Tue Feb 12 18:48:00 CST 2019 0 1754
Vue$nextTick理解

Vue$nextTick理解 Vue$nextTick方法将回调延迟到下次DOM更新循环之后执行,也就是在下次DOM更新循环结束之后执行延迟回调,在修改数据之后立即使用这个方法,能够获取更新后的DOM。简单来说就是当数据更新时,在DOM渲染完成后,执行回调函数。 描述 通过一个简单 ...

Sat Jul 04 03:11:00 CST 2020 0 1547
vue.nextTick()方法简单理解

的执行的应该是会对DOM进行操作的 js代码; 理解nextTick(),是将回调函数延迟在下一 ...

Sat Oct 10 20:11:00 CST 2020 0 482
关于vuenextTick深入理解

一、定义[nextTick、事件循环]    nextTick的由来:     由于VUE的数据驱动视图更新,是异步的,即修改数据的当下,视图不会立刻更新,而是等同一事件循环中的所有数据变化完成之后,再统一进行视图更新。    nextTick的触发时机 ...

Thu Aug 31 23:05:00 CST 2017 0 8127
vuenextTick()的理解及使用场景

异步更新队列: 首先我们要对vue的数据更新有一定理解vue是依靠数据驱动视图更新的,该更新的过程是异步的。 即:当侦听到你的数据发生变化时, Vue将开启一个队列(该队列被Vue官方称为异步更新队列)。 视图需要等队列中所有数据变化完成之后,再统一进行更新。示例 ...

Fri Jul 10 23:25:00 CST 2020 0 1790
vuenextTick()的理解及使用场景说明

异步更新队列: 首先我们要对vue的数据更新有一定理解vue是依靠数据驱动视图更新的,该更新的过程是异步的。 即:当侦听到你的数据发生变化时, Vue将开启一个队列(该队列被Vue官方称为异步更新队列)。 视图需要等队列中所有数据变化完成之后,再统一进行更新。示例 ...

Thu Aug 08 22:54:00 CST 2019 0 1681
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M